Olá galera, estou com um problema para contar quantas vezes um mesmo número aparece na sequência. Neste caso, queria saber quantas vezes o nº 12 aparece, para colocar a soma de todas elas numa célula só. No caso a soma tem que dar igual a 7. E essas sequências estão na mesma linha com colunas diferentes. Ex.:(a1=11,12,12; b1=05,12; c1=01,12,12,12; d1=12,14; e na célula e1=7 vezes). Obrigado!!!
Qual será o máximo de sequências numéricas separadas por vírgulas que terá em cada célula, de A até D?
Boa noite
Estou sem o Libre, mas testei aqui no Excel e funcionou perfeitamente.
Trata-se de uma fórmula matricial, portanto, no final, em vez de teclar ENTER, tecle CTRL+SHIFT+ENTER que automaticamente serão inseridas chaves, no início e no final da fórmula.
=SOMA((NÚM.CARACT(A1:D1)-NÚM.CARACT(SUBSTITUIR(A1:D1;12;"")))/NÚM.CARACT(12)) & " vezes"
Dê retorno.
[]s
Olá, muito obrigado. Realmente dá certinho. Porém, se usado num intervalo certo. Se eu usar em células alternadas, dá erro . É possível usar essa fórmula de forma que o intervalo não seja sequencial, mas alternado? Ex.: em vez de A1:G1, ser A1;C1;E1;G1? Obrigado.
Eu fiz uma adaptação na sua fórmula aqui que deu certo, rsrsrs. Usei a mesma fórmula para cada célula que eu queria. Ficou grande, mas dá o mesmo resultado.
=SOMA(((NÚM.CARACT(C1)+NÚM.CARACT(E1)+NÚM.CARACT(G1))-(NÚM.CARACT(SUBSTITUIR(C1;12;""))+NÚM.CARACT(SUBSTITUIR(E1;12;""))+NÚM.CARACT(SUBSTITUIR(G1;12;""))))/NÚM.CARACT(12)) & " vezes"
Só fiquei com uma dúvida para compreender a fórmula. Pq no final, divide-se o resultado da soma por 12? Muito obrigado pela ajuda.
Não divide por 12, divide pelo número de caracteres, experimente colar apenas =NÚM.CARACT(12) numa célula pra você ver o resultado.